Scientologists' Gifts To London Police Questioned

The British press has disclosed that London police officers have accepted gifts and entertainment worth thousands of pounds from the Church of Scientology. Reuters on Wednesday reported that the police department has opened a review of its hospitality policy after it was disclosed that invitations to charity dinners, music concerts and a film premiere were among the gifts, most of which were approved by senior officers. Police apparently developed a relationship with Scientologists when the group helped police last July in dealing with the suicide attacks on the London transit system.
